This is a great rivalry. Buffalo has poor attendance and everytime they play it is 75%-25% in favor in Toronto fans IN Buffalo. Cities only 1.5 hrs apart. It is almost impossible to get tickets in Toronto so the Leaf fans invade Buffalo.
